You have an earlier generation 105 rear der with same or later age rx100 and what looks like a tiagra shifter which is what replaced rx100, a clearly older adjustable stem from something cheap. This is not a build that someone would have done custom when the bike was new, can't imagine anyone deciding they needed to do a "custom" cannondale bike and thinking the first thing they're going to do is slap rx100 on it. This is the definition of a parts bin bike which is fine, it doesn't mean it can't be a good and enjoyable bike to ride but still a parts bin bike. Custom also suggests a special build that the time it was purchased, not upgraded over time.
